Lindauer, S.E., DeLeon, I.G. & Fisher, W.W.(1999). Decreasing signs of negative affect and correlated self-injury in an individual with mental retardation and mood disturbances.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 32, 103-106.

We evaluated the effects of an enriched environment, based on a paired-choice preference assessment, on both rates of self- injurious behavior (SIB) and percentage of session intervals during which signs of negative affect were displayed by a woman with mental retardation and a mood disorder. Results suggested that SIB and signs of negative affect were highly correlated and that the enriched environment effectively reduced both.

DESCRIPTORS: environmental enrichment, self-injurious behavior, mood disorder, developmental disabilities
